@extends('layouts.admin-modern') @section('title', 'Gestion des Utilisateurs') @push('head') @endpush @section('content')

Gestion des Utilisateurs

Gérez tous les utilisateurs de la plateforme TaPrestation.

Total : {{ $users->total() ?? 0 }} utilisateur(s)
Nouvel utilisateur

Total Utilisateurs

{{ $users->total() ?? 0 }}

+ 8% ce mois

Utilisateurs Actifs

{{ $users->where('is_blocked', false)->count() ?? 0 }}

+ 12% ce mois

Administrateurs

{{ $users->where('role', 'administrateur')->count() ?? 0 }}

Stable

Nouveaux ce mois

{{ $users->where('created_at', '>=', now()->startOfMonth())->count() ?? 0 }}

+ 15% vs mois dernier

Liste des utilisateurs

{{ $users->total() ?? 0 }} utilisateur(s) trouvé(s)

Tout sélectionner
@forelse($users ?? [] as $user)
{{ substr($user->name, 0, 1) }}

{{ $user->name }}

{{ $user->email }}

{{ ucfirst($user->role) }} {{ !$user->is_blocked ? 'Actif' : 'Bloqué' }}
Inscrit: {{ $user->created_at->format('d/m/Y') }}
Dernière connexion: {{ $user->last_login_at ? $user->last_login_at->diffForHumans() : 'Jamais' }}
@if(!$user->is_blocked) @else @endif
@empty
Aucun utilisateur trouvé
Essayez de modifier vos critères de recherche
@endforelse
@if($users && $users->hasPages())
Affichage de {{ $users->firstItem() }} à {{ $users->lastItem() }} sur {{ $users->total() }} résultats
{{ $users->links() }}
@endif
@endsection @push('styles') @endpush @push('scripts') @endpush